When it comes to frozen fish, how long it lasts in the freezer depends on the type of fish and how it was processed before being frozen. For example, fresh fish that has been frozen will only last for about two to three months, whereas commercially processed fish can last for up to two years. In general, however, most frozen fish will be safe to eat for up to six months.
